














[SN JD24005786] USED Fender / Made in Japan Limited Edition Cyclone Butterscotch Blonde [06]
Made in Japan in 2024.
Fender Official Shop exclusive model.
The Made in Japan Limited Cyclone is a reissue of the highly popular Mexican-made model.
Featuring a compact offset body shape similar to the Mustang, a 24.75-inch medium scale, and a vintage-style tremolo unit identical to that of the Stratocaster, this is a visually distinctive model.
The Made in Japan Cyclone Humbucking and Made in Japan Cyclone Single-Coil pickups, developed exclusively for this model, deliver a powerful, well-defined, unique, and versatile tone.
Furthermore, the Modern āCā-shaped maple neckāwith a 24.75-inch medium scale, satin finish, 22 medium-jumbo frets, and a 9.5-inch radius fingerboardāensures comfortable playability and reduces fatigue even during long playing sessions. The satin neck finish feels smooth to the touch and provides a natural feel.
